Section 358.370. Right to wind up.


MO Rev Stat § 358.370. What's This?

Right to wind up.

358.370. Unless otherwise agreed the partners who have not wrongfully dissolved the partnership or the legal representative of the last surviving partner, not bankrupt, has the right to wind up the partnership affairs; provided, however, that any partner, his legal representative or his assignee, upon cause shown, may obtain winding up by the court.

(L. 1949 p. 506 37)
